AI Summary

  • Amends the definition of "end user" in waste tire regulations to mean a person who uses tire-derived products (rather than just processed waste tires) for commercial or industrial purposes.

  • Extends the repeal date of the Processors and End Users Fund from July 1, 2012 to July 1, 2020, continuing the program that provides monthly reimbursements up to $65 per ton of processed Colorado waste tires.

  • Transfers appropriation authority to the General Assembly for disbursing fund moneys, and requires the Department not to reimburse processors unless the tire-derived product has been end-used or sold for end use and moved off-site.

  • Directs the Department to identify other markets in Colorado capable of eliminating illegal tire dumping and recycling waste tires in newer technologies without relying on taxpayer or cleanup funds.

  • Appropriates $700,000 from the Processors and End Users Fund to the Department of Public Health and Environment for fiscal year 2011-12 to reimburse processors and end users.
